BS | Saturday | Intro to Python Coding & Robotics Lab | Ages 10+

 

 

Adventures in Coding: An Exciting Journey for Young Minds!

This class designed to teach STEM, programming, and computer science concepts and skills in a fun & engaging setting using a wide range of programmable electronics and programming software.

 

 


This course is designed specifically for young innovators who already have foundational block-based coding experience, this semesterlong course bridges the gap between drag-and-drop programming and real-world text-based engineering.
 
This is not a traditional screen-only coding class—it is an interactive hardware lab. Students will write live Python code to interact with the physical world, transforming CyberPi and BBC micro:bit microcontrollers into handheld gaming consoles, smart sensors, and automated robotic systems. Alongside physical hardware, students will expand their programming skills using powerful interactive software tools—such as debugging digital games in Trinket.io, conquering syntax quests in CodeCombat, and writing code to mix original audio soundtracks via Georgia Tech's EarSketch platform.
Key Learning Objectives
  • Robotic & Hardware Engineering: Learn how text-based software commands interact with physical input/output pins, internal sensors, and physical circuitry.
  • Block-to-Text Mastery: Accelerate learning by directly translating known block concepts (loops, variables, logic) into native Python syntax.
  • Physical & Digital Integration: Alternate between programming physical hardware triggers and developing web-based digital graphics.
  • Gamified Problem Solving: Earn "XP" through speed-typing quests, error-hunting challenges, and collaborative peer-to-peer debugging battles.

 

Ages 10 +   
Course Level Beginner & Intermediate
Course Language ENGLISH (Note: the software only supports English - the language used in JAVA )
Financial Aid
Location BASEL | TechLabs ELYS
Elässerstrasse 215
4056 Basel Stadt
Date 2026-08-15 – 2026-12-12
Time 10:00 – 12:00
Status Open for registrations
Weekday Sat
Lessons 15 Lessons
Price CHF 810.00
E-mail [email protected]

BS | Saturday | Intro to Python Coding & Robotics Lab | Ages 10+

No. Date
1 2026-08-15
2 2026-08-22
3 2026-08-29
4 2026-09-05
5 2026-09-12
6 2026-09-19
7 2026-10-17
8 2026-10-24
9 2026-10-31
10 2026-11-07
11 2026-11-14
12 2026-11-21
13 2026-11-28
14 2026-12-05
15 2026-12-12